Biography
Born in Berlin in 1963, Armin Völckers spent his early years in Rio de Janeiro before returning to Germany with his parents. He studied fine arts at the Academy of Art in Berlin from 1983 to 1988, and his work was featured in over 50 exhibitions in Germany, other European countries, and the U.S. After gaining experience in film as a producer of animated series, script editor and creative director, Völckers began working as a freelance screenwriter in 1997. He directed his first film in 2005, the 19-minute short "Leroy räumt auf" ("Leroy Cleans Up"), which has received several awards, including Best Short Film at the festival in St. Petersburg and the BMW Förderpreis at the Film+ Festival in Cologne. Völckers used the same material as the basis for his first full-length feature, "Leroy" (2007).
